This morning I am reading in the book of Luke chapter 9. Got me to thinking about how tired my children and grand children must have been after a 20-21 hour day yesterday, as they traveled back from an away football game. In this passage we see that the disciples have had a really busy week as well. They have come to a Samaritan village, after this grueling week, and have been told there is no room available for them. “Lord, should we call down fire from heaven to burn them up?” James and John suggested. “Yeah!” someone else agreed. “Let’s vap-o-rize them!” Jesus didnt say anything. However I am betting that the expression on His face made it clear that if He was going to vaporize anyone, His vengeful disciples would be first. Instead He turned around and walked down the road toward the next village. OK, so maybe they didnt use the word vaporize but it’s not that far off. This much is true: Even though the disciples had an accurate idea of Jesus’ power - He could have “vaporized” that Samaritan village, they had an inaccurate understanding of Jesus’ self-control - He controlled His power (and maybe even His desire) to destroy that village. The story illustrates the fact that God not only commands self-control because He values it, but He also values self-control because He is self-controlled. God isnt controlled by His emotions. He’s not controlled by outside influences. He’s not controlled by circumstances. He is self-controlled! You and I should be happy about that. Were it not for the Lord’s self-control, I am pretty sure that I would have been vaporized long ago! We should also be grateful because God’s self-control helps us to know that self-control is right - even when we’re tempted to vaporize a village. The Lord is long-suffering and slow to anger, and abundant in mercy and loving-kindness, forgiving iniquity and transgression; . . . Numbers 14:18a Think about it! SELAH!
